How they compare
Albania currently reports 6.96 kg/ha against 6.81 kg/ha in Guatemala, a difference of 0.15 kg/ha.
Across all 63 years both countries report, Albania has been ahead every year.
Albania ranks 78th and Guatemala ranks 79th of 200 countries.
Albania has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Albania | Guatemala |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 8.84 kg/ha | 2.82 kg/ha | 6.01 kg/ha | Albania |
| 1970s | 7.73 kg/ha | 3.34 kg/ha | 4.39 kg/ha | Albania |
| 1980s | 9.85 kg/ha | 3.09 kg/ha | 6.76 kg/ha | Albania |
| 1990s | 11.99 kg/ha | 4.35 kg/ha | 7.64 kg/ha | Albania |
| 2000s | 12.21 kg/ha | 6.11 kg/ha | 6.1 kg/ha | Albania |
| 2010s | 10.75 kg/ha | 6.76 kg/ha | 4 kg/ha | Albania |
| 2020s | 7.93 kg/ha | 6.78 kg/ha | 1.15 kg/ha | Albania |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
